>>About half the people taking the Maine Guide test fail each year.  The
>>majority fail trying to solve the "lost person scenario".  This is part of
>>the oral review and the scenario changes.  Typically you are the guide(or
>>leader on a club outing)with a group of beginning kayakers.  One kayaker
is
>>"lost".  What do you do?
>>Example:  You are leading your group through a group of islands.  The wind
>>has freshened and due to varying abilities to cope with the conditions the
>>group has gotten more spread out than you would like.  While you are
trying
>>to get your group closer together you make a quick count and notice that
>>your are one member short.  You cannot see the person anywhere and there
is
>>no response to a shouted call or a whistle.  What do you do?
>>This is just one scenario.  Others could include fog, rainstorm(squall),
>>getting dark, etc.
